As the season winds down, let's take a look at a player who started her career at Duke before transferring to another school.  While such players are not updated here regularly, their seasons are usually summarized.  Chelsea Hopkins returned to Maccabi Ramat Hen, again proving to be the best all-around point guard in Israel.  The team had a championship aspirations again, but fell short against the team that also plagued them last year.  Chelsea's passing and other statistical contributions were noticed as she was given another chance in WNBA training camp, but she did not make the final cut.

Alana Beard, Angela Salvadores, and Avenida hosted Haley Peters and Uni Girona in Game 3 of the Finals with the winner becoming the champions of Spain.  The home team dominated to win 67-46 as Alana had 5 points in 24 minutes while Haley had 5 points in 16 minutes and Angela did not play.  In the win, Jelena Milovanovic had 20 points and 10 rebounds and Erika De Souza had 15 points.  Alana joined the team midseason again, helping them win the league before heading to her final WNBA season.  Haley moved teams in Spain again, having another strong season.  Angela had a solid first professional season, taking her chances when they came to her on a very talented team.
